Transaction 85eda28acca36935c94da6fd62d707e4a58e301fcd253e69443c071356237c31
1 Input
1 Output
-
85eda28acca36935c94da6fd62d707e4a58e301fcd253e69443c071356237c31:0
- value
- 22264342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 537e26232591f91009a3036e1066df36de42291e OP_EQUAL
- address
- 39JV8T4BaZ76kemYBGs2836Zpx3u9xkibW